Adaptive Algorithms for the Simultaneous Stabilization and Decoupling of Multivariable Systems
Department of Electrical Engineering, University of Glasgow Glasgow
Five dual-purpose adaptive decoupling and pole-assignment algorithms are derived. They are all hybrid explicit algorithms, consisting of a continuous-time control law and a discrete-time identification algorithm. The algorithms are shown to stabilize the closed-loop system by consideration of the behaviour of slowly time-varying systems, and also to decouple the system and correctly assign the closed-loop poles.
